Features of This Machine (continued)

• Sheet/Cover Insertion
Insert up to 30 blank or copied sheets from any tray including the Multi-Sheet Bypass
Tray, or insert blank or copied front and back covers from any tray including the Multi-
Sheet Bypass Tray.

• Stamp/Overlay
Imprint a stamp, watermark, or scanned image onto the copy image.

• Staple
Select the stapling position and number of staples (3 positions).

• STD Size (Special)
Detect the standard paper sizes which cannot normally be detected (A4R and A5) when
loaded in a main body tray. A5R and F4 sizes will also be available when loaded in the
Multi-sheet bypass tray.

• Text/Photo Enhance
Enhance photo image in Photo mode; regular image in Auto mode; enhance text image
in Text mode; enhance lighter image in increase contrast mode.

• Transparency Interleave
Copy onto transparency film and interleave blank or copied paper for each original
copied.

• Userset Density (USERSET 1, USERSET 2)
Output up to 16 density samples on a total of 4 pages that display 4 samples per page,
then program the desired density under USERSET 1 and/or USERSET 2.

• Weekly Timer
Can be set according to the needs of each work environment. Turn main body power
Off/On daily or weekly, during lunch time, on holidays, and also enable the timer-
interrupt mode, which allows temporary use of the machine even when the machine is in
the daily, weekly, or holiday Off mode.

• Wide Size Paper
Copy onto paper slightly larger than the specified regular size.

• Z-Folded Original
This feature sets the RADF to accept Z-folded originals.
